Subject: Partner SFTP drop — new owner

Hi,

As you review the pending changes to the Harborline ingest scripts, note that ownership of the partner SFTP drop is changing at the end of the month. This includes key rotation, the nightly pull job, and the quarantine folder for malformed files. Review comments on the retry logic should still go through the normal PR flow, but questions about drop-folder conventions or partner onboarding now go to the new owner. The incoming owner is listed below.

signatory, tagaf-bahaf: Praael Fenmir Rusok

### 2.11.0 — Key rotation

Rotated the artifact signing key for Billforge, the PDF invoice renderer. The previous key reached its scheduled expiry; no compromise is suspected. All builds from this version onward are signed with the replacement. Verification against the old key will fail for new artifacts, which is expected. Future maintainers should update any pinned verifiers to the key below.

signing key of bagap-yawep = bky13_TbfT6ZMUoGJo2

# Support Outsourcing Plan (Managers Only)

Finance team: Kervalt Industries will transition tier-1 customer support to Merrow Partner Services over two quarters. Projected savings: 1.4M credits annually after transition costs. Headcount impact handled via redeployment where possible. Contract terms are final; invoicing begins next cycle. Budget lines update in March. Strategic background appears in the confidential note below.

management briefing: Project Ulavan slips by two quarters because of the staffing delay.